Overview
In 2024, Gaya averaged an AQI of 110 while Tirumala averaged 89 — a 21-point (24%) gap, with Gaya the more polluted and Tirumala the cleaner of the two. On 106 days when both cities reported, Tirumala was cleaner on 78 of them; the average daily gap was 149 AQI points.
Seasonality & days
Gaya peaks in January, while Tirumala peaks in November. Gaya logged 1.7% Severe days and 32%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Tirumala was 0% Severe and 65.8%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Gaya 52 days, Tirumala 39 days.
Year-over-year progress
The worst recorded day for Gaya reached AQI 500 at Collectorate (BSPCB) on 2016-10-15; Tirumala hit AQI 173 at Toll Gate (APPCB) on 2016-12-30.
Station-level disparity
Gaya spans 3 CPCB stations with a 85-point spread (min 88, max 173); Tirumala spans 1 stations with a 0-point spread (min 89, max 89).
